Product Overview

Category

The MMSTA42-7-F belongs to the category of semiconductor devices.

Use

It is commonly used in electronic circuits for amplification and switching purposes.

Characteristics

  • Small form factor
  • High gain
  • Low power consumption
  • Fast switching speed

Package

The MMSTA42-7-F is typically available in a small surface-mount package.

Essence

This device is essential for amplifying and controlling electrical signals in various electronic applications.

Packaging/Quantity

It is usually packaged in reels or tubes, with quantities varying based on manufacturer specifications.

Specifications

  • Maximum Collector-Base Voltage: 75V
  • Maximum Collector Current: 500mA
  • Power Dissipation: 625mW
  • Transition Frequency: 250MHz
  • Operating Temperature Range: -55°C to 150°C

Detailed Pin Configuration

The MMSTA42-7-F has three pins: 1. Collector (C) 2. Base (B) 3. Emitter (E)

Functional Features

  • High voltage capability
  • Low saturation voltage
  • Excellent high-frequency performance

Advantages

  • Compact size
  • Versatile application range
  • Reliable performance

Disadvantages

  • Limited maximum current handling capacity
  • Sensitive to overvoltage conditions

Working Principles

The MMSTA42-7-F operates based on the principles of bipolar junction transistors, utilizing the control of current flow for signal amplification and switching.

Detailed Application Field Plans

The MMSTA42-7-F finds extensive use in: - Audio amplifiers - Signal processing circuits - Switching power supplies - RF amplifiers

Detailed and Complete Alternative Models

Some alternative models to MMSTA42-7-F include: - BC547 - 2N3904 - 2SC945 - PN2222A

In conclusion, the MMSTA42-7-F is a versatile semiconductor device with a wide range of applications in electronic circuits, offering compact size and reliable performance. Its characteristics make it suitable for various amplification and switching tasks, although users should be mindful of its limitations in current handling and susceptibility to overvoltage conditions.
